Quick Comparison
Not every event space needs the same flooring. Plastic deck-style tiles are a strong fit for outdoor patios, tents, and uneven ground. Drainage tiles are better when water, spills, or cleanup speed matter most. Peel-and-stick vinyl tiles work well for smoother indoor surfaces where you want a cleaner decorative finish. If you need a more polished look for dancing or presentations, look for systems with tighter locking edges and a flatter walking surface.
Key Buying Factors for Waterproof Event Flooring Tiles
Surface Type and Traction
Think first about where the tiles will go. Smooth vinyl styles can look refined, but textured plastic and drainage designs usually offer better slip resistance in busy event environments.
Water Management
If your event might face rain, spills, or frequent cleaning, prioritize Waterproof Event Flooring Tiles with drainage channels, open grid designs, or non-slip surfaces that shed moisture quickly.
Installation Speed
For rentals, pop-up events, and short-term setups, tool-free interlocking tiles are often the easiest choice. Peel-and-stick products are more suitable when you have a stable, clean subfloor and want a longer-lasting application.
Load and Traffic Demand
Heavier foot traffic, carts, or dance use call for rigid, impact-resistant materials. Lighter-duty tiles may work for decor or low-traffic areas, but they should not be stretched beyond their intended use.
Cleanup and Reuse
Reusable tiles can save money over time, especially if you host multiple events. Easy-clean surfaces and modular replacement pieces are valuable if one section gets damaged or stained.
Who Should Buy Which Waterproof Event Flooring Tiles?
Choose plastic interlocking tiles if you want the most versatile all-around option for patios, outdoor events, and fast setups. Go with drainage-focused tiles if moisture control and grip are top priorities. Pick peel-and-stick vinyl if your project is indoors and aesthetics matter as much as function. For dance floors and higher-end event spaces, look for flatter, more stable systems that feel secure underfoot and present well in photos.
In short, the best choice depends on whether your priority is appearance, drainage, portability, or durability. Matching the tile style to the venue will give you the safest and most professional result.
